Alan Sable is a Partner in the Real Estate & Lending practice group.  Alan has over 31 years of experience offering legal advice in all areas of commercial real estate law, including purchases and sales of office, retail, multifamily, and affordable housing properties; office and retail leasing transactions; real estate development transactions, including obtaining land use and zoning approvals and other entitlements; real estate financing transactions including affordable housing transactions under various HUD programs; and commercial real estate receivership matters.  Alan is often sought after for advice on realty transfer taxes, including structuring real estate transactions to minimize the impact of realty transfer taxes. 

In addition to advising clients in transactional matters, Alan has served as an expert witness on real estate title issues in federal and state court litigation matters and is a licensed title insurance agent who operated a commercial title insurance agency affiliated with his prior law firm.

Alan’s experience also includes zoning, land use, and permitting matters, such as PennDOT highway occupancy permits and similar entitlements, as well as other commercial business transactions.  In addition, Alan serves as counsel to receivers in receivership matters involving retail and other distressed commercial real estate assets.

Previously, Alan was a founding member of Sable and Sable, LLC, a successful, community focused law firm that assisted clients for more than seven years.  Immediately prior to that, Alan was a partner in the Pittsburgh office of Reed Smith LLP, a Pittsburgh-based AmLaw 100 law firm.
